Jenny Mustard is a Swedish blogger known for her minimalist and edgy style. We met in Berlin to talk about the differences between French style and Scandinavian style... in 10 questions: 5 questions in my video and 5 question in her video.

The biggest thing I noticed when I studied in France was how muted people's outfits were. Lots of black, everything well tailored or form fitting, barely any baggy clothes, and white sneakers or black/tan chunky heels were popular when I was there. The ankle thing with guys where the pants are almost "flooding" or cuffed shorter was popular there before it was here in the states. Everybody wore nice shoes. Nobody was walking around with scuffed or peeling shoes unless they were another exchange student.
